OFFICAL PROJECT DESCRIPTION

In their response to antigens, antibodies undergo a process called affinity maturation where they pick up mutations that help increase their affinity for the antigen.

This is an integral part of the humoral immune response.

There are tools to decode what these mutations are, but the role of these mutations in influencing antibody dynamics remains largely unclear.

Understanding how antibody dynamics change throughout the course of affinity maturation would help in designing highly specific antibody therapeutics and vaccine immunogens.
This project aims to simulate a range of antibody affinity maturation pathways.

We have multiple lineages we would like to track.

These are all lineages that have led to potent antibodies and have published structures available.

For each lineage, we are simulating a naïve antibody and a mature antibody.

Similar studies conducted in the past have used short
simulations and have simulated only the variable regions of the proteins.

Here, we will generate large simulation datasets that include the constant regions as well as the variable regions, giving us a more accurate glimpse into antibody dynamics.

Our hope is that these simulations will uncover the dynamics that are responsible for highly specific and potent antibodies, helping to improve antibody design in the future.
p18265 – PGT121 lineage, naïve antibody.

The PGT121 lineage antibodies
are broadly neutralizing antibodies that bind to the V3-glycan epitope on
the HIV envelope protein gp120.
p18266 – PGT121 lineage, mature antibody.

The PGT121 lineage antibodies
are broadly neutralizing antibodies that bind to the V3-glycan epitope on
the HIV envelope protein gp120.
p18267 – CAP256-VRC26 lineage, naïve antibody.

The CAP256-VRC26
lineage antibodies are broadly neutralizing antibodies that bind to the V2-
apex epitope on the HIV envelope protein gp120.
p18268 – CAP256-VRC26, mature antibody.

The CAP256-VRC26 lineage
antibodies are broadly neutralizing antibodies that bind to the V2-apex
epitope on the HIV envelope protein gp120.
p18269 – CH65-CH67 lineage, naïve antibody.

The CH65-CH67 lineage
antibodies bind to the receptor binding site on the influenza hemagglutinin
protein. p18270 – CH65-CH67 lineage, mature antibody.

The CH65-CH67 lineage
antibodies bind to the receptor binding site on the influenza hemagglutinin
protein.
p18271 – CH103 lineage, naïve antibody.

The CH103 lineage antibodies are
broadly neutralizing antibodies that bind to the CD4 binding site epitope on
the HIV envelope protein gp120.
p18272 – CH103 lineage, mature antibody.

The CH103 lineage antibodies
are broadly neutralizing antibodies that bind to the CD4 binding site epitope
on the HIV envelope protein gp120.
p18273 – 1-18 lineage, naïve antibody.

The 1-18 lineage antibodies bind to
the CD4 binding site on the HIV envelope protein gp120.
p18274 – 1-18 lineage, mature antibody.

The 1-18 lineage antibodies are
broadly neutralizing antibodies that bind to the CD4 binding site on the HIV
envelope protein gp120.
